Включение POST запрашивает на файлы HTML в IIS7

При рассмотрении приобретения знаний о маршрутизаторах и сетях на том уровне трудно обыграть DynaMIPS и Dynagen как бесплатный ресурс. Все еще необходимо овладеть одним (или больше), изображения IOS для работы виртуальных маршрутизаторов Cisco и некоторых вещей трудно сделать в DynaMIPS.

Это не поддерживает аппаратное обеспечение коммутатора эмуляции (из-за большого количества очень специализированного кремния в Коммутаторе Cisco), таким образом, трудно экспериментировать с VLAN (некоторые вещи могут быть сделаны с помощью многопортовых плат Ethernet и делая VLAN там, но некоторая функциональность VLAN (частные VLAN, являющиеся одним), может только быть сделана в переключателе IOS).

В то время как можно проводить политику QoS, не обязательно легко протестировать их на точность в рамках установки DynaMIPS.

5
задан 23 May 2017 в 15:41
2 ответа

Таким образом, похоже, что публикация в html-файлах невозможна в IIS без установки внутреннего языка для интерпретации html-файлов, а не обработчика статических файлов IIS. Если кто знает другое, дайте мне знать! (Чтобы прояснить, у Apache нет этой проблемы.)

Сообщение, на которое ссылается @ JudasIscariot1651, работает, однако требует установки ASP и нарушит работу вашего сайта, если вы используете язык серверной части, который не ASP (предположительно, только при размещении на html-страницах - я не смог проверить). Вам необходимо настроить любой язык, который вы используете для обработки html-файлов вместо статического обработчика файлов.

Если вы не используете внутренний язык или используете ASP, вот копия версии ASP (права доступа изменен на пример в сообщении) - сначала установите ASP и ISAPI:

<add name="html" path="*.html" verb="*" modules="IsapiModule" scriptProcessor="%windir%\system32\inetsrv\asp.dll" resourceType="Unspecified" requireAccess="None" />

Если вы используете PHP, вам необходимо использовать следующее (отрегулируйте настройки PHP) - предположительно у вас уже установлены PHP и CGI:

<add name="html" path="*.html" verb="*" modules="FastCgiModule" scriptProcessor="C:\Program Files (x86)\PHP\php-cgi.exe" resourceType="Unspecified" requireAccess="None" />
4
ответ дан 3 December 2019 в 01:40

Добавьте модули ISAPI и добавьте обработчик обработки сценария для файлов "* .html", сопоставление их, например, обработчика asp по умолчанию, в файле web.config.

См. это сообщение в блоге: http://zhongchenzhou.wordpress.com/2011/12/05/iis-7-7- 5-allow-post-requests-to-html-files /

1
ответ дан 3 December 2019 в 01:40

Теги

Похожие вопросы